My first career as a cruise ship entertainer had me sailing all over the world, living and working aboard these large floating resorts for six to eight months at a time. After years of roaming the world’s ports and experiencing every ship and shoreside scenario that you could imagine, I became adept at packing a single suitcase to ensure a comfortable life at sea. 

Although living on a ship long-term is different from taking a 10-day cruise, crew and guest cruise packing lists are similar — emphasizing items that make sailing more comfortable and easy. Whether you’re embarking on a world cruise or just escaping to the Caribbean for a quick trip, these essential travel accessories are what my fellow seafarers and I would suggest bringing to make life on the water all the more comfortable. From versatile travel bags to helpful gadgets and genius seasick remedies , here’s what to pack for a cruise like a pro. 

Travel Voltage Converter

Most ship staterooms are outfitted with a three-prong 110-volt (North America-grounded) and a 220-volt (Europe) outlet. It’s always a good idea to carry an international adaptor and surge protector to safeguard your devices from electric irregularities. What's more, smaller interior cabins may have only two outlets, which could pose a problem if you and your guest have multiple devices to charge at the same time. Useful for more than just onboard, an internal adaptor is also handy for cruise itineraries that drop you off in multiple countries. Keep this adaptor in your day bag so you can plug it in ashore if your tech needs a charge.

Portable First Aid Kit 

Visits to the ship’s medical center can be pricey. Avoid this unexpected expense if you can by bringing  your own first aid kit. Start by packing your essential prescription medications. Then,  add bandages and antibiotic ointment for attending to small surface wounds. Bring pain relief medication and cold medicine, just in case. Don’t forget antacids and over-the-counter medicines to ease digestion. Sunscreen and aloe vera gel are must-haves  so you don’t spend your whole cruise hiding from the sun. Bug repellent and after-bite lotion will also ease your sleep if you’ve run into sand fleas at the beach. If you have any allergies, make sure that you have an EpiPen or your chosen allergy medication.

Non-Drowsy Seasick Patches 

If your itinerary is taking you through rough waters, like the Drake Passage or the Tasmanian Sea, be prepared with remedies to fight motion sickness. More than 11,500 reviewers swear by these seasick patches that use a holistic herbal blend to fight nausea. The onboard medical center offers Dramamine to seasick guests, which will make you sleepy and groggy. If you want to stay alert while fighting the nausea, these non-drowsy patches are the way to go. A few crew tips for fighting sea stomach: stay on the upper levels of the ship, munch on green apples, and keep your eyes on the horizon.

Gifts for Cruise Crew Members that Are Most Appreciated

Tips & cash.

cruise crew bags

Yes, cash is king. This might be obvious, but the best “gift” you can give your cruise cabin steward, waiters and even your favorite bartender, is a nice tip.

Even if you auto or prepay your gratuities on a cruise, giving extra cash above and beyond the cruise ship gratuity is very much appreciated by cruise ship staff.

Crew members often send money home to their families. Money can also be used to purchase any items that they need, including wifi or SIM cards, so cash is very useful.

Edible Gifts (Chocolates & Candies)

cruise crew bags

Crew member cabins are usually very small. Therefore there isn’t a lot of space to keep items you may bring onboard as a gift. However, cruise ship crew can enjoy and share any edible gifts like chocolates and other treats.

If you know the crew member, you may have an idea of his or her preferences. For example, does he or she like salty snacks like chips or Doritos?

In most cases you won’t really know, but bringing a box of chocolates or local treats from home is a nice gesture.

Toiletries & Convenience Items

cruise crew bags

For some time after the cruise restart, many cruise ship crew members weren’t able to get off the cruise ship when in port. This meant getting convenience items and toiletries was a challenge.

For this reason, some cruise passengers brought basic items and toiletries like shampoo, deodorant, toothpaste and moisturizer to cruise ship staff. Through the grapevine, I’ve heard more recently, that crew aren’t as much in need of these items anymore as they can either get off the ship or order things to the cruise ship that are delivered.

If you feel it’s appropriate, you can always ask a crew member if you can pick them up anything while in port of call.

Positive Comments

Cruise Tip: take photo of crew member nametag

While tangible gifts like tips and chocolates are nice, something that can make a huge difference for cruise crew members is leaving positive comments on surveys and comment cards.

When cruise ship staff get positive comments and feedback, this goes a long way towards their career with the cruise line. Good ratings can mean promotions onboard and even rewards and privileges onboard their cruise ship.

When you get off the cruise ship after disembarkation, you’ll be sent an online survey to review your cruise experience. Make sure to fill it out and use this this as an opportunity to highlight any cruise ship staff that made a positive impact on your cruise vacation .

Cruise Ship Crew Travel Procedure Luggage Manual

cruise crew bags

The Cruise Company is NOT responsible for expenses incurred as a result of lost,  damaged or excess baggage (Extra, overweight, oversized baggage fee)  while joining / leaving Company vessels.

TRAVEL TIPS:

Below are some general tips when preparing to travel:

1. Be sure to attach a luggage tag to each baggage that will be checked in at theairport. It is recommended that luggage tags be attached to all carry-on items in case these items are left in the airplane overhead bin.

2. Inside each bag, place a copy of your itinerary (i.e. flight details, hotel details, joining letter) along with contact information.

3. Be sure to remove any old airline tags that were placed on your baggage from previous trips.

4. As so many bags look alike, it is recommended that crew attach something (i.e. stickers or labels) to their baggage that is easy to distinguish and identify at a glance.

5. It is recommended that you bring a small amount of clothing items in your carry-on. If your baggage gets lost, you will have some clothes to change into.

6. Make a note of what type of bags (color, type, and manufacturer) and any distinguishing characteristics. Having this information will be helpful should you have to report lost baggage.

BAGGAGE ALLOWANCE POLICY:

Please consult the individual airline's baggage policy prior to travel as airlines are constantly changing their respective Checked & Carry-on Baggage policy. In the event an airline charges a checked baggage fee (not an excess baggage fee) or a fee for a 2nd baggage to be checked in, please retain your receipt(s) in order to submit a claim for reimbursement.

NOTE : Claims for reimbursement for 3 or more checked baggage or for excess baggage fees will not be considered unless otherwise stipulated in the crew member's employment agreement. (Check your employment contract agreement )

Please refer to Section 63.02.01 TRAVEL INCIDENT AND CLAIMS PROCEDURES:

Checked Baggage:

Piece Concept Policy: When travelling to/from the U.S. or Canada, each piece of luggage should not exceed a linear dimension (length+width+height) of 62" and a weight of 50 lbs/23 kg. Maximum 2 bags allowed.

Weight concept Policy: This system is used in all areas except where the "piece" concept is used. Each piece should not exceed a linear dimension (length+width+height) of 62" and a weight of 44 lbs/20 kg. Maximum 2 pieces allowed only.

Carry-on Baggage:

When travelling to/from the U.S. or Canada, most carriers allow one carry-on item.

* 1 purse, briefcase, or camera bag

* or 1 laptop computer (computers cannot be checked and must be carried on);

* or 1 item of a similar or smaller size to those listed above

Size Restrictions:

To avoid delays as well as fees, follow these general size requirements:

* Baggage may not exceed 45 linear inches (or 115 cm) in combined length, width, and height

* Baggage must fit easily in the Carry-on Baggage Check, which is located near the check-in counters and at the gate, and is approximately 22" x 14" x 9" or 56 x 36 x 23 centimeters.

EXCESS BAGGAGE POLICIES

Crew and Officers may be subject to an excess baggage fee if maximum baggage allowance is exceeded. Unless otherwise stipulated in the crew member's employment agreement, the Company is not responsible for excess baggage fees when joining/leaving a vessel.

Please contact the airline directly or visit their website to review their current Excess Baggage Policy.

Music Managers and Musicians:

Music Managers and Musicians who incur excess baggage fees for their equipment may submit a claim by sending a completed claim form and original receipts directly to the Manager of Air Services.

LOST BAGGAGE:

If a crew member or Officer finds that his/her baggage did not arrive, they should do the following:

1. Go to the Airline's Baggage Claim Office located at the airport and file a report.provide contact details(i.e. cell phone number and/or email address), as well as a detailed description of your baggage.

2. Make sure the representative processing your claim provides you with a phone number as well as a Baggage Claim tracking number before leaving the airport in order to follow up on the status of your claim.

3. If joining a vessel, please notify the Port Agent so they can assist in tracking the status of your claim and advise them that they may send an e-mail notification to the Crew SAP/ Crew Manager of the vessel if baggage is located after sailing. The Port Agent will assist in forwarding the baggage to the next suitable port. Princess Cruises agrees to cover the Port Agent fees and shipping fees to have the luggage forwarded to the next port (these fees range from $40 to several hundred dollars depending on the distance involved.)

4. Once onboard a vessel, crew member must contact the Crew SAP / Crew Manager to inform them of the missing luggage, and provide the Crew Office with the claim information from the airline. Crew members should also provide the Crew SAP / Crew Manager an itemized list of belongings in each missing luggage piece and the approximate value.

5. Crew members will be issued a complimentary toiletry kit and will receive complimentary laundry services for five days or until luggage is delivered to the ship, whichever occurs first.

6. If luggage has not been recovered by the 3rd day, shipboard management may authorize a $50 voucher from crew Club funds to be given to the crew member for the purchased if incidentals. It is the responsibility of the HR Manager / Crew Club Treasurer to track all lost luggage costs.

7. In the event the luggage is not recovered, the crew member is encouraged to make a claim to the airline for lost luggage. Claims may take several weeks to be resolved; therefore it is at the discretion of shipboard management to issue an additional voucher for up to 200.00 USD from the Crew Club fund. These funds should be reimbursed by the crew member once the lost luggage claim is resolved.

8. Costs for lost luggage are to be tracked and may be submitted at the end of the year to Fleet Personnel, Employee Relations Manager. Consideration will be given to reimbursing the Crew Club from monies available. Costs will only be reimbursed to the shipboard Crew Club fund to the level of allotted funds available within the Crew Welfare budget. Any funds available in the budget will be distributed equitably amongst the fleet.

Cruise ship worker says there are six things you should never do while on one

Cruise ship worker says there are six things you should never do while on one

Listen to those who spend much more time on them than you.

Tom Earnshaw

Tom Earnshaw

A cruise ship worker has explained exactly what you should never do when setting sail - and some of the pointers might shock you.

The summer season is almost upon us and with that, a boom in travel as millions head on their annual breaks abroad.

And for many Brits , Spain is the go to destination with recent guidance giving the 16 million UK residents heading there a sigh of relief .

But some fancy something a little different, with the likes of cruise ship excursions extremely popular if you can afford them .

With one cruise ship staff member recently explaining why you should 'get ready to spend a lot of cash' on one thing in particular , another in the industry is here with six things she says you should never do if you're getting ready to set sail on any boat.

Tammy Barr has been sailing around the world , working on cruise ships, for years on end before now doing it as a customer.

Originally shared with Business Insider, here are six things she says she would never do following her experience as a cruise ship worker and now customer.

A big no-no to the drinks package

For many, this is the big question before setting sail across the world. But for Tammy, you shouldn't pay if your drinking habits aren't on the overindulgent side of things.

"I enjoy a pina colada by the pool or a Manhattan while listening to a jazz set after dinner," she says.

"Even so, it doesn't make sense for me to pay in advance for 12 to 15 cocktails a day."

Who doesn't love a cocktail (Getty Stock Images)

For Tammy, the math doesn't add up especially if the trip you're on will see you leaving the ship for multiple port-heavy trips. Going ashore means less time on the ship to drink its booze.

"I prefer to buy as I go and take advantage of happy hour and other drink specials that are available on certain cruise lines. I also check the beverage policy in advance and bring on my own wine, if allowed," she says.

Touching surfaces

It's time to utilise those elbows and knuckles with Tammy never using her fingers to touch stuff in the public areas such as elevator buttons.

"Some cruise lines are better than others at wiping down commonly touched surfaces, but I don't take any chances," she says.

"I avoid touching things others frequently touch, and I wash my hands frequently."

Illnesses such as norovirus can quickly spread on cruise ships, given there are thousands of people in a confined space, so taking this little measure could be the different between holiday bliss and holiday bliss.

A cruise ship in port (Getty Stock Images)

Upgrading your food

Most cruise liners will include the main dining room meals in your package, which is one part of why the price is so much, given you're essentially paying for perks like this in advance.

But if you want something fancy, expect to pay more on top.

Tammy says that, while ' $12 may not seem like much for a steak of lobster tail', it defeats the point. She will stick to what she's got.

Calling the ship by the wrong name

A quirky one from Tammy, but one that comes down to looking the part when you're on board.

She says: "Ships have proper names, and so do not require a definite article. For example - 'Tomorrow I am embarking on Discovery Princess' or 'I enjoyed scenic cruising on MS Westerdam'."

Basically if you want to look savvy and knowledge, drop the 'the' before the ship name. It's just not correct.

Cruise ships at port (Getty Stock Images)

Room key does not go around your neck

Tammy thinks this is a bit naff for a few reasons. For one, it can be seen as flaunting your status by showing off how often you cruise.

No one likes a show off really and the longer you are at sea, the fancier your room key.

It's also an invitation to those who have sinister means. She says: "In port, that room key bouncing off your chest looks like an invitation to be robbed. It screams 'I have money! Come and take it from me'."

Virgin Voyages cruise ship in Sydney (Matt Blyth/Getty Images)

There's no need for super busy port day

The idea of missing your cruise ship's departure and being stranded somewhere on the other side of the world is mortifying.

For Tammy, the best way to avoid this is to have pretty chilled port days so you're never at serious risk of missing your cruise ship before it leaves port.

"I've never missed a sail away, but I have cut it too close at times and have had to run down a pier or two. Just recently, as a passenger, my taxi driver got lost returning our group to the port at night," she says.

"When I realised how late we were going to be, I forked over $8 per minute to be connected with the ship. I pleaded with them to wait for us. It was a sprint through the port to get back on and we received quite a scolding from the first officer."

Coast Guard pulls Carnival cruise crew member from ship off Florida coast

Related video: Coast Guard medevacs pregnant woman aboard Disney cruise

TAMPA, Fla. (WFLA) — The U.S. Coast Guard said it pulled a crew member from a Carnival ship off the coast of Florida on Sunday afternoon.

Officials said the U.S. Coast Guard Air Station Clearwater MH-60 helicopter crew medevaced the 35-year-old crew member from the Carnival Sunshine.

The crew said it hoisted the ailing man and the ship’s nurse and took them to a medical center in Melbourne.

Photos from the Coast Guard show officials hovering over the ship to help the crew member.

Officials did not say what happened to the crew member or his condition.

According to CruiseHive , the ship was one day into its five-night sailing to the Bahamas. The Carnival Sunshine left Charleston, South Carolina on Saturday.

Nearly 200 people sick in norovirus outbreaks on Royal Caribbean, Princess Cruises ships

cruise crew bags

Nearly 200 people got sick in norovirus outbreaks on Princess Cruises and Royal Caribbean International ships.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ention said 94 of the 2,532 guests on Sapphire Princess reported being ill during its April 5 cruise, along with 20 crew members. The round-trip cruise, which left from Los Angeles with stops in Hawaii and the South Pacific, will end on May 7, according to CruiseMapper .

On Royal Caribbean’s Radiance of the Seas, 67 of its 1,993 guests reported being ill in addition to two crew members during a cruise that ended April 22, according to the CDC . The two-week voyage sailed from Tampa, Florida to Los Angeles with stops in countries like Colombia and Panama, according to CruiseMapper .

In both outbreaks, the guests and crew members’ main symptoms were diarrhea and vomiting.

Princess, Royal Caribbean and the ships’ crews implemented heightened cleaning and disinfection measures and isolated those who were sick, among other steps, the health agency said.

"Onboard the most current sailing of Sapphire Princess, there have been a small number of cases of mild gastrointestinal illness among passengers, the cause likely is the common but contagious virus called Norovirus," a Princess spokesperson told USA TODAY in an emailed statement. "At the first sign of an increase in the numbers of passengers reporting to the medical center with gastrointestinal illness, we immediately initiated additional enhanced sanitization procedures to interrupt the person-to-person spread of this virus. Our sanitization program, developed in coordination with the CDC, includes disinfection measures, isolation of ill passengers and communication to passengers about steps they can take to stay well while onboard."

Royal Caribbean did not immediately respond to a request for comment.

The CDC has logged six outbreaks of gastrointestinal illness on cruise ships that met its threshold for public notification since the beginning of the year. Norovirus was listed as the causative agent in five, while one was unknown.

The illness is often associated with cruise ships but outbreaks occur in communities on land as well, according to Dr. Sarah E. Hochman, a hospital epidemiologist and the section chief of infectious diseases at NYU Langone Health’s Tisch Hospital.

“There's not something special or unique about cruise ships,” she said. “It's really any type of congregate setting, but it's also happening out in the community on a much smaller scale among households and household contacts. It just doesn't come to the attention of public health as much as it does for larger congregate settings.”

Hochman said the virus is “incredibly infectious” and congregate settings tend to have many shared surfaces, such as handrails in cruise ship stairwells or elevators. “And so, if you just have one person who's shedding the virus and touches the surface and then someone else touches it and then touches their mouth, that's how it can spread in those types of settings.”

Cruise ship medical facilities: What happens if you get sick or injured (or bitten by a monkey)

Alcohol-based hand sanitizer isn't as effective against norovirus, and Hochman emphasized that washing hands with soap and water “will do a lot to prevent the spread.”

The news comes after more than two dozen Silversea Cruises guests got sick in a gastrointestinal illness outbreak on the luxury line’s Silver Nova ship during a sailing that began in late March.

L.A. gangsters used painter suits, assault rifles and zip ties for brazen armored car heists

A Brinks truck

  • Show more sharing options
  • Copy Link URL Copied!

The driver had stepped out of the Brinks truck to make a cash delivery at a Taco Bell when he saw the gun.

The man holding the AR-15 wore a white painter suit. He fumbled for the driver’s keys and handed them to a similarly dressed accomplice, who climbed inside the armored car. A minute ticked by. The driver stared down the muzzle of the rifle. Then a shout from the truck: “Hey, let’s go!”

Police found the getaway car abandoned half a mile away. The cash and the suspects were gone.

The heist last June in Reseda was the work of a crew that targeted armored cars in a series of sophisticated robberies across Los Angeles County that netted six-figure hauls, authorities say. After casing their targets and studying routines for weeks, the crew waylaid drivers as they picked up or delivered bulk cash at banks, credit unions, markets, fast-food restaurants and a check-cashing business, according to a search warrant affidavit reviewed by The Times.

The crew was composed of ex-convicts from the West Boulevard Crips, East Coast Crips and Black P Stone gangs, some of whom had met while serving time in state prison, according to court records.

Thieves recently managed to carry off a staggering $30 million from a cash storage facility in Sylmar and loot millions of dollars in jewelry from an idling Brinks truck without firing a shot — heists that have confounded investigators and made fodder for headlines around the world. But meanwhile, a very different operation — brazen and lightning-quick robberies committed in broad daylight — played out on the streets of L.A., with all the twists and turns of a Hollywood thriller.

The case took authorities from a darkened oil field in Baldwin Hills to a predawn standoff in the San Fernando Valley, where one member of the crew refused to go quietly.

But for another suspect, the police were too late. They found his body on the side of a road with a bullet in his head.

A ski mask, an AR-15 and bags of cash

The crew first struck in February 2022. An armored car driver was picking up cash from a Wescom Credit Union in Hawthorne when three men approached him, FBI Special Agent Elizabeth Cardenas wrote in an affidavit.

One wore a ski mask and a yellow security guard shirt. He forced the driver to the ground at rifle-point.

With the muzzle of the rifle pressed into the driver’s head, two others grabbed bags of cash and checks. They fled in a white Honda Accord with $166,640, according to one of the suspect’splea agreement.

Over the next year, the crew held up armored car drivers outside a Bank of America branch in Inglewood, a 99 Cents Only Store on Crenshaw Boulevard and a check-cashing business at the intersection of La Brea Avenue and Adams Boulevard, according to Cardenas’ affidavit.

Suspect wanted for a series of armored car robberies.

A Brinks driver was making a delivery at PLS Check Cashers when he noticed a green laser sight being pointed at him, the agent wrote. Three masked men approached, one holding what the driver described as a “submachine gun.”

Their orders were confusing, the driver said. They told him to lie down, then stand up, then get on his knees. After seizing his keys and gun, the suspects took bags of money from the truck, Cardenas wrote. The haul totaled $374,168.

Authorities identified two half-brothers, James Russell Davis and Deneyvous Hobson, as suspects. Three weeks before the first job in Hawthorne, an employee at the credit union had called the police to report something suspicious: a white Chevrolet Tahoe circling the branch for an hour. Its occupants seemed to be photographing a delivery of cash from an armored car.

Officers pulled over the Tahoe and questioned Davis and Hobson, who showed identification that listed an address in the West Adams neighborhood. When detectives and agents searched the Chesapeake Avenue house in October 2022, they seized a surveillance system that showed getaway cars used in the heists had been parked outside the home, Cardenas wrote.

James Russel Davis

Davis is a member of the West Boulevard Crips, according to a search warrant affidavit, while Hobson is from the Black P Stones. Questioned during a traffic stop by Los Angeles County sheriff’s deputies, Hobson disavowed his gang ties.

“I went all the way legit, man, all the way legit,” he said, according to a transcript of the conversation.

Hobson was arrested in February 2023. Davis was captured a month later after the FBI went public with a manhunt and a $25,000 reward. Neither man’s lawyer returned requests for comment.

Davis pleaded guilty in February to robbery and gun charges, admitting he cased the Wescom Credit Union and acted as a lookout. He faces a minimum of 10 years when he is sentenced in June. Hobson has pleaded not guilty and is set to stand trial in September.

But even as the half-brothers sat in a federal detention center, the heists continued.

Gone in 20 seconds

The morning of June 10, 2023, a Brinks armored car pulled into the parking lot of a 7-Eleven at the intersection of Florence Avenue and Crenshaw Boulevard. One of the drivers stayed in the truck while the other went inside to make a pickup.

As he returned with the money, a man wearing a white jumpsuit stepped out of a white Lexus SUV holding a rifle, Det. Emily Delph of the LAPD’s Robbery-Homicide Division wrote in a search warrant affidavit.

He shoved the driver to the ground and took the bag of cash while a second suspect trained a rifle on the driver inside the truck. “Let’s go!” the driver of the Lexus shouted. “Hurry up!”

The Lexus, which was registered to an Arkansas limited liability company, was found abandoned in a nearby alley. It’s unclear how much cash was taken during the robbery, which lasted just 20 seconds, according to Delph’s affidavit.

Seventeen days later, the crew held up the Brinks driver at the Taco Bell on Reseda Boulevard. Police found the getaway car parked half a mile away on a residential street. The silver Toyota CHR had been reported stolen at 12:35 a.m. that morning in West Adams, Delph wrote.

In the final heist linked to the crew, a Brinks driver was robbed while filling ATMs in South Los Angeles the morning of Oct. 16.

“Based off of the manner in which the robberies occurred, the similarities of the weapons used and the attire that the suspects wear, I believe the above-listed robberies are connected,” Delph wrote.

Combing through Hobson‘s and Davis’ phone records, detectives found they’d been communicating during the robberies with a number used by Jadie Lee Young Jr., a 30-year-old member of the West Boulevard Crips who’d served 12 years in prison for assault, Delph wrote.

Young was arrested on suspicion of possessing a gun as a felon in June 2023. Inside his truck, police found more than $10,000 in cash packaged “similar to the manner in which Brinks bundles their money,” Delph wrote. Young told the officers he’d recently bought the truck and moved into a new apartment in Windsor Hills.

Detectives got a warrant for Young’s phone records. They showed he was near the 7-Eleven during the robbery and in the area of the Taco Bell two weeks before the heist, which indicated he was casing the location, Delph wrote.

But before the LAPD could arrest Young, another police agency found him first.

A leap as cops come calling

Young lay on the side of Fairfax Avenue, among the nodding derricks of the Inglewood oil field. Sheriff’s deputies found the body at 4 a.m. on Dec. 20.

Det. Ray Lugo of the Sheriff’s Department’s Homicide Bureau said Young was believed to have been shot in the head in the LAPD’s jurisdiction before his body was dumped in the hills outside the city.

His death is being investigated by the LAPD, Lugo said. Delph declined to comment on Young’s homicide.

In her affidavit, the detective said she learned Young was communicating during the 7-Eleven and Taco Bell robberies with a number subscribed to Zeff Rocco, an East Coast Crip who’d done prison time for carjacking.

On Rocco’s iCloud account, detectives found photographs of guns resembling those used in the robberies, Delph wrote. Rocco also shared a photograph of bundles of cash the day of the Taco Bell heist, according to Delph’s affidavit.

At 5 a.m. on March 21, a SWAT team assembled in the stairwell of a Reseda Boulevard apartment building. “Zeff Roco, this is the LAPD!” an officer shouted into a bullhorn, according to body camera footage released last week. “Come out with your hands up and surrender immediately!”

cruise crew bags

An officer managed to reach Rocco on the phone. “We’ve been waiting and our patience is growing thin,” he said, “so I need you to surrender and come out.”

Rocco hung up. Surveillance cameras captured him clambering over the balcony of his third-floor apartment, wearing only shorts and sneakers and carrying an assault rifle. He jumped down to a grass dog run and fumbled for the rifle.

“He’s got a gun!” an officer yelled before opening fire. “Don’t reach for it! Don’t reach for it! Let it go!”

The officer fired again. “Let it go! Stop reaching for it!” Four more shots boomed out.

Inside the dead man’s apartment, police found high-capacity magazines and body armor, an LAPD spokeswoman said.

That same morning, detectives arrested Disaac Jones, 33, whose DNA was found on a glove left inside the getaway car used in the 7-Eleven heist, according to Delph’s affidavit.

Jones was released on $150,000 bond after pleading not guilty to two counts of robbery. He declined to comment.

Emirates told cabin crew to report for duty during historic Dubai flood despite government's stay-at-home warning, report says

  • A historic flood brought the most rain in 75 years to the United Arab Emirates.
  • Over 800 flights have been canceled at Dubai International Airport since Tuesday.
  • Despite a stay-at-home warning, Emirates has reportedly encouraged cabin crew to report for duty.

Insider Today

Emirates flight attendants in Dubai were told to still report for duty while a flood left much of the city's airport underwater.

A memo sent to the airline's cabin crew was obtained by the " A Fly Guy's Cabin Crew Lounge ," a Facebook page where aviation industry staff share gossip and stories.

It encouraged staff to make their way to the airport despite the government telling people to stay at home.

"We are operating our flights safely, and it's important our operations carry on for the sake of our customers," the email reportedly read.

It added: "If you are rostered for duty, please continue to make your way safely to work."

Aviation news site Paddle Your Own Kanoo first reported the memo as posted on Facebook.

Related stories

Emirates did not respond to a request for comment from Business Insider.

Videos and pictures shared by the Facebook page, which has over one million followers, appear to show Emirates cabin crew struggling through the flood waters.

Other clips showed cabin crew covering themselves with plastic bags to protect their uniforms from the rain.

A group of Emirates cabin crew saving themselves and their uniform during historic Dubai rain/flood. 🎥Credit : LIONE$$ @The_Lioness13 #Dubai #Dubaifloods pic.twitter.com/eK7WjDURg9 — FL360aero (@fl360aero) April 18, 2024

The media office for the Emirati government said the country witnessed the largest amount of rainfall in 75 years.

Schools in the United Arab Emirates were closed until the end of the week, while federal government employees were told to work remotely.

At Dubai International Airport , some planes tried to battle through the flood. Its terminals began to reopen early Thursday morning local time, although the airport said on X: "Flights continue to be delayed and disrupted."

54% of flights leaving Dubai International on Tuesday were canceled, according to data from FlightAware . More than 800 flights have been canceled over the past three days.
